Flake: Republican presidential candidate supporting gay marriage ‘inevitable’

Arizona Republican Sen. Jeff Flake said Sunday that a Republican presidential candidate in support of gay marriage is “inevitable,” but he remains steadfast in his beliefs that marriage is only between a man and woman.

Tagg apologized to Obama for ‘take a swing’ comment, Romney camp says

Republican presidential candidate Mitt Romney’s son Tagg has apologized to President Barack Obama for saying in a radio interview that he was tempted to “take a swing” at the president for criticizing his father during a debate.
